TIGNAL WADE

BirthABT 1771 - North Carolina
Death1850 - Muhlenberg, Kentucky, United States
MotherMary Wade
FatherHenry Wells 1748 Wade (Marg MaryAnn)

Born in North Carolina on ABT 1771 to Henry Wells 1748 Wade (Marg MaryAnn) and Mary Wade. TIGNAL WADE married Lois Strait and had 14 children. He passed away on 1850 in Muhlenberg, Kentucky, United States.
